Of course, it's not justified. But the Kent State Massacre was a seminal moment during the war in Vietnam. By then, even the most hard-core pro-war types were starting to get sick of the whole thing, particularly as the number of dead soldiers flashed across TVs from coast to coast each evening. And then, all of a sudden, people's children were being mowed down by gunfire in a safe haven of a university campus by national guardsmen ill-prepared for a peaceful confrontation. If anything, hearts and minds were directed away from support for the war than toward it.
